😐Monthly costs for one person with rent: $1,247 in Tbilisi versus $946 in Cotonou.
😐Estimated couple costs with rent: $2,025 in Tbilisi versus $1,477 in Cotonou.
😐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$2,803 in Tbilisi versus $2,009 in Cotonou.
🌍Living in Tbilisi is roughly 32% more expensive than in Cotonou, driven mainly by Clothing & Footwear.
📊Both cities sit below the global median: Tbilisi9% lower, Cotonou31% lower.

🏠A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$682 in Tbilisi and $182 in Cotonou.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.
💰Tbilisi pays 150%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.
🛒Dining out: $39.00 in Tbilisi vs $37.00 in Cotonou for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$232 vs $230 per month, with Cotonou cheaper across the board.
